1. Roof Dimension
Roof measurement is a major determinant of restore prices. Bigger roofs require extra supplies, growing expenditure. This relationship is straight proportional: a roof twice the dimensions necessitates roughly double the supplies, impacting each materials and labor bills. For example, repairing a small leak on a single-story ranch will sometimes value lower than repairing an analogous leak on a big, multi-story house, even when the harm itself is equivalent.
Correct roof measurements are important for acquiring exact value estimates. Contractors sometimes calculate roofing space in squares, the place one sq. equals 100 sq. ft. Understanding this unit of measurement permits for a clearer comparability of quotes and a extra knowledgeable evaluation of venture scope. A bigger roof space additionally interprets to elevated labor hours for duties like shingle elimination, underlayment set up, and flashing restore. This prolonged labor contributes considerably to the general value.

4. Extent of Injury
The extent of roof harm straight correlates with restore prices. Minor harm, resembling a number of lacking or cracked shingles, sometimes requires localized repairs, leading to decrease bills. Conversely, intensive harm, maybe attributable to extreme climate occasions or long-term neglect, can necessitate partial or full roof alternative, considerably growing prices. A small leak, for example, would possibly require solely patching and sealant software, costing a number of hundred {dollars}. Nonetheless, widespread storm harm, requiring important shingle alternative, sheathing restore, and doubtlessly new flashing, may value hundreds. The reason for the harm additionally influences the scope of restore. Affect harm from a fallen tree department, for instance, usually necessitates extra intensive repairs than wear-and-tear from ageing.

5. Roof Accessibility
Roof accessibility considerably impacts restore prices. Ease of entry dictates the effort and time required for repairs, straight influencing labor bills. Troublesome-to-access roofs require specialised tools, security precautions, and doubtlessly longer working hours, growing total venture prices.
-
Roof Pitch and Slope
Steeper roofs current better challenges for staff, requiring specialised security tools and doubtlessly slowing down the restore course of. A low-slope roof permits for simpler motion and quicker repairs, whereas a steep, multi-pitched roof will increase labor time and complexity. This elevated threat and complexity translate to greater labor prices. For instance, repairs on a walkable flat roof will usually value lower than repairs on a steep, sloped roof requiring specialised security harnesses and doubtlessly scaffolding.
-
Surrounding Panorama
Obstacles surrounding the home, resembling dense timber, shrubs, or restricted clearance, impede entry and enhance restore complexity. Obstacles necessitate maneuvering tools and supplies in confined areas, doubtlessly growing labor time and threat. A home surrounded by open area permits for simpler tools placement and materials dealing with, lowering labor hours. Nonetheless, a home nestled amidst dense landscaping necessitates cautious navigation, doubtlessly requiring specialised tools like cranes for materials lifting, thus growing bills.
-
Constructing Peak
Multi-story buildings current better logistical challenges for roof entry in comparison with single-story buildings. Taller buildings usually necessitate specialised tools, resembling scaffolding or aerial lifts, to achieve the roof, including to venture prices. Repairing a single-story ranch-style house sometimes requires less complicated, inexpensive entry options, resembling ladders. Conversely, repairing a three-story constructing requires extra advanced and dear entry preparations, impacting total bills.
-
Roof Design Complexity
Advanced roof designs, that includes a number of valleys, hips, and dormers, enhance the problem and time required for repairs, influencing labor prices. Intricate roof buildings require meticulous consideration to element, specialised flashing strategies, and doubtlessly customized materials fabrication, all contributing to greater bills. A easy gable roof permits for easy repairs, whereas a roof with a number of intersecting planes and valleys will increase complexity and labor, impacting total venture prices.

6. Location
Geographic location performs a big position in figuring out roof restore prices. Regional variations in materials costs, labor charges, and constructing codes contribute to fluctuating bills. Understanding these location-specific elements offers helpful context for budgeting and knowledgeable decision-making.
-
Materials Availability and Price
Materials availability and related prices fluctuate regionally. Areas with available assets sometimes expertise decrease materials costs, whereas distant areas or areas vulnerable to particular climate occasions would possibly face greater prices as a result of transportation and demand. For instance, available asphalt shingles in a densely populated space will probably value lower than specialised roofing supplies transported to a distant island. Equally, areas vulnerable to hailstorms would possibly expertise elevated demand and subsequently greater costs for impact-resistant roofing supplies.
-
Labor Charges
Labor charges differ considerably throughout completely different geographic areas. Price of residing, market demand for expert tradespeople, and native financial situations affect hourly charges for roofing professionals. Metropolitan areas with a excessive value of residing usually command greater labor charges in comparison with rural areas. Equally, areas experiencing a development increase would possibly see inflated labor prices as a result of elevated demand. This variance straight impacts the general expense of roof restore, whatever the extent of injury.
-
Constructing Codes and Allowing
Native constructing codes and allowing necessities affect restore prices. Stringent laws relating to supplies, set up practices, and inspections add to venture bills. Areas with particular seismic or wind load necessities, for instance, necessitate specialised supplies and development strategies, growing total prices. Equally, areas vulnerable to wildfires would possibly mandate fire-resistant roofing supplies, impacting venture budgets. Allowing charges additionally differ by location, including to the general expense.
-
Local weather Issues
Regional local weather situations affect materials choice and restore frequency, not directly impacting long-term prices. Areas experiencing frequent excessive climate occasions, resembling heavy snowfall, hailstorms, or hurricanes, require extra sturdy and weather-resistant roofing supplies, doubtlessly growing upfront bills. Nonetheless, investing in strong supplies can cut back long-term restore frequency and total prices. Conversely, areas with milder climates enable for a wider vary of fabric selections, doubtlessly providing extra budget-friendly choices.
